Dana Nelson, a humanities teacher at Leaders, wins this year’s Gaynor McCown Award for Excellence in Teaching for building authentic learning experiences and fostering a student-led community at the school.

Read an excerpt from NYC Outward Bound Schools’ webinar on SEL, during which Hon. Mark Treyger, NYC Council Member and Chair of the Committee on Education, named Leaders High School as a model for how relationship-building should be implemented in schools city-wide.
Gabriella Babskiy, a senior at Leaders High School, a NYC Outward Bound School in Bensonhurst, Brooklyn, was featured in a NY1 story about students who are changing their college plans due to COVID-19.

History teacher, Kevin Mears, was honored with the 2017 Gaynor McCown Excellence in Teaching Award by NYC Outward Bound Schools.
Senior Shazzarda Davis was invited to speak at the NYC Outward Bound Schools’ 30th Anniversary Gala and introduced the evening’s honorees, Cathy and Marc Lasry.
